Now you should also be looking to acquire some “OJT” (on-the-job training). The very first time you shop for and eventually purchase a parcel of real estate, you’ll begin to accumulate experience; but is there a way to get OJT without actually having to purchase anything?

There are a few ways to do this. One way is to “tag along” with another real estate investor who agrees to let you observe him or her in action. This doesn’t mean you have to haunt or shadow that person, but you could, for example, sit in on a real estate closing or accompany him or her while presenting an offer to purchase. You may not even have to do that much if the person will record the session (with everyone’s permission of course) or at least take good notes and review them with you later. But perhaps the most comfortable type of OJT for all parties concerned is attending additional seminars and workshops given by experts in the real estate field. Also, you should join one or more real estate investment clubs and/or groups. I would suggest you contact the American Association of Real Estate Investors, which has its national office located in Tucker, Georgia.
